Final Discernment
As we head towards the end of our time we ask that you spend at least one half hour in silent reflection.
Perhaps reading the Online Stations of the Cross or experiencing the seven last words of Jesus or simply journaling can be part of this experience. Our main purpose here is to reflect not only on our lives and our retreat experience–but rather, how we have come to know God and to examine where we miss God’s presence and where we can shore up our resolve to keep God in the center of our lives.
